body {
	font-size: 12px; margin:0px; padding:0px;
	color:#333333;
	line-height:20px;
}
ul,li,form{ margin:0; padding:0; list-style:none;}
h1,h2,h3,h4,h5,h6{ margin:0px; padding:0px;display:inline; }
a:link{
	text-decoration: none;
	color:#333333;
}
a:visited {
	text-decoration: none;
	color:#333333;	
}
a:hover {
	text-decoration: none;
	color: #E13323;
}
a:active {
	text-decoration: none;
	color:#333333;
}
.clear1{ clear:both}
.huline{ border:1px solid #cfcfcf; margin-top:5px; }
.hongline{ border:1px solid #e5ac8f; margin-top:5px; }
.bailine{border:1px solid #dec060; margin-top:5px; background-color:#FFFFFF;}
.ren{padding:5px;}

.top10{
	background-image: url(../images/n010.gif);
	background-repeat: no-repeat;
	background-position: left top; padding:5px 5px 5px 30px; line-height:23px;
}
.hongbiaoleft{  font-size:14px; font-weight:bold; color:#ffffff;}

.hongbiao{
	background-image: url(../images/n005.gif);
	background-repeat: no-repeat;
	background-position: left top; height:34px; line-height:34px; padding-left:20px;	
}
.baibiao{
	background-image: url(../images/n012.gif);
	background-repeat: no-repeat;
	background-position: left; height:27px; line-height:27px; padding-left:30px;	
}

.hubiao{
	background-image: url(../images/n009.gif);
	background-repeat: no-repeat;
	background-position: left; height:27px; line-height:27px; padding-left:35px;	
}
.hongbiaoleft2{font-size:14px; font-weight:bold; color:#ee5d00;}
.more{font-size:12px; font-weight:bold; color:#ffffff;}
.hubiaoleft{  font-size:14px; font-weight:bold; color:#000000;}
.baibiaoleft{  font-size:14px; color:#ffffff;}
.ren ul li{
	line-height:25px;
	overflow:hidden;
	background-image: url(../images/n016.gif);
	background-repeat: no-repeat;
	background-position: left; padding-left:16px;	
}

.imgline{ border:1px solid #cfcfcf; padding:3px;}

/*λ*/
.box{ width:1000px; margin:0px auto;}
.top{}
.logo{}
.nav{ width:110%; padding-left:0px;}
.nav ul li{
	float:left;
	background-image: url(../images/n001.gif);
	background-repeat: repeat-x; height:30px; line-height:30px; padding:0px 7px; margin:0px 5px; font-size:14px; border:1px solid #e0e0e0; 
}
.nav h2{ font-size:14px;}
.navzi{
	background-image: url(../images/n002.gif);
	background-repeat: repeat-x; height:35px; line-height:35px; padding:0px 10px; color:#FFFFFF;
}
.navzi li{ float:left; text-align:center; padding:0px 5px;}
.so{
	border:1px solid #e7e7e7;
	background-color: #FFFFFF;
	background-image: url(../images/n003.gif);
	background-repeat: repeat-x;
	background-position: top;
}
.soso{
	background-image: url(../images/n004.gif);
	background-repeat: repeat-x;
	background-position: top; height:41px; line-height:41px; padding:0px 10px;
}
.soso li{ float:left; text-align:center; padding:0px 5px;}
.content1{ width:100%;}
	.content1_left{ float:left; width:730px;}
		.leftcontent1{ width:100%;}
			.leftcontent1_left{ float:left; width:300px;}
				.fandanpian{background-color:#fcf8ed; margin-top:5px; border:1px solid #f3e5be; padding:5px;}
			.leftcontent1_right{ float:right; width:420px;}
	
	.content1_right{ float:right; width:240px; background-color:#fcf8ed; margin-top:5px; border:1px solid #f3e5be; padding:5px; }
	.content1_right2{ float:right; width:250px;  }
		.newn{
	border:1px solid #cfcfcf;
	margin-top:5px;
	background-image: url(../images/n006.gif);
	background-repeat: repeat-x; height:25px; line-height:25px; padding:0px 5px;
}
	.newtop{
	background-image: url(../images/n007.gif);
	background-repeat: repeat-x;
	background-position: top;border:1px solid #cfcfcf;
	margin-top:5px; padding:5px;
}
.tubiao{
	background-image: url(../images/n008.gif);
	background-repeat: no-repeat; height:34px; line-height:34px; padding-left:30px; color:#FF0000;
}
.tubiaonew{
	background-image: url(../images/n015.gif);
	background-repeat: no-repeat;
	background-position: left top; height:25px; padding-left:30px; padding-top:15px;
}
	
.tujina{ width:100%; padding:5px 0px;}
.tujina ul li{ float:left; padding:0px 12px; text-align:center;}	
	
.content2{ width:100%;}
	.content2_left{ float:left; width:725px;}
	.content2_right{ float:right; width:260px; }
.xiaoshuolist td{ height:30px; border-bottom:1px solid #f3f3f3;}
.footer{ border-top:1px solid #ebc8a8; margin-top:5px; text-align:center;}

/*list*/
.listshu{ width:715px; border:1px solid #cfcfcf; padding:5px; margin-top:5px;}

.listnext{ border:1px solid #cfcfcf; margin-top:5px; height:30px; line-height:30px; text-align:center; }
.d_page{margin-top:5px; height:30px; line-height:30px; text-align:center; clear:both;}


.list_con_box{}
.list_con_box_t{ background:url(../images/tit_bg2.gif) repeat-x; height:27px; line-height:25px;}
.list_con_box_c{ padding:5px; line-height:25px;}
.list_con_box_c h3{ background:url(../images/news_ico.gif) no-repeat 5px 0px; padding-left:15px;}
.list_con_box_c p{ text-indent:20px; line-height:25px;}

/*show*/
.rentop{
	border:1px solid #cfcfcf;
	background-color: #FFFFFF;
	background-image: url(../images/n017.gif);
	background-repeat: repeat-x;
	background-position: left top; margin-top:5px; padding:5px;
}
.renbiao{text-align:center;  padding:10px; line-height:25px;}
.renzuzi{ width:100%; line-height:30px; border-bottom:1px dashed #cfcfcf;}
.renzuzi ul li{ float:left; padding:0px 10px;}
.renjs{ width:100%; padding:10px 5px;}
.renjsleft{ float:left; width:230px;}
.renjsright{ float:left; width:720px;}
.xiaoshumutop{
	background-image: url(../images/n018.gif);
	background-repeat: no-repeat;
	background-position: left; height:27px; margin-top:5px;
}
.xiaoshumuline{ border:1px solid #ced9df; padding:5px 20px;}
.xiaoshumubiao{ background-color:#fffbe8; border-bottom:1px solid #fed883;  border-top:2px solid #fed883; line-height:35px; padding-left:20px; margin-top:15px; }
.xiaoshumusm{ font-size:14px; line-height:25px;}
.xiaoshumuren{ width:100%;}
.xiaoshumusm ul li{ float:left; width:327px; border-top:1px dashed #cfcfcf; line-height:30px;
	overflow:hidden;
	background-image: url(../images/n016.gif);
	background-repeat: no-repeat;
	background-position: left; padding-left:16px;	}
	
.det_txt_box{}
 .det_txt_box li{ float:left; width:45%; text-align:center; font-size:14px; font-weight:bold;}